Halogen lamps or 'Hello no lamps'? But then as in 'cheap halogen lamps'. Those are the wonderful things of which you have two for the 1 euro 99 with the Action and similar price stunters. And that is too expensive. Except for emergencies.

In the classic that one of our employees has to bring through the winter, a couple of those budget lamps were put into it. Just. Because they were there and because it is a nice feeling to go to the RDW with fresh headlights.

The car got the full disapproval of its 'light image' of the cheap halogen lamps. Instead of a clear, sharply defined light image, the 'Chinaware' lamps projected a few faint fog spots.

And even the proud owner of the car could not but give the RDW judge the same as the disapproval.

With a pair of Philips White Visions (say 25 euros) behind the lenses, the license plate inspection a week later was no problem.

The same judge only had to check the light image of the car.
He had already found the rest to be in order.
